#AF22CE presents itself as a energetic, saturated magenta — one that sits on the lighter side of the spectrum. In practice it works well for bold branding moments and attention-grabbing details. In The Official Register of Color Names it is just a few steps away from Barney (#AC1DB8). Nearby in the Register you will also find Dark Orchid (#9932CC) and Vivid Mulberry (#B80CE3).
Technically, the mix leans on its blue channel (rgb(175, 34, 206)), which gives #AF22CE its character. If you plan to put text on a #AF22CE background, choose white — the contrast ratio is 5.3:1 (passing WCAG AA), while black manages only 3.9:1. #AF22CE has no official name yet. #AF22CE color harmonies
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.
Complementary
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.
Split complementary
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.
Analogous
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.
Triadic
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.
Tetradic
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
Square
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
